THEMES INCLUDE: animals, Australiana, Christmas, Educational themes, families, fantasy and magic, foods and fads, limericks, multiculturalism, nature and the environment, social gatherings, sports, stuff and nonsense, sun, surf and sand, travel, war and lots of "characters".
|
Moving On Authors:
Illustrated by Dulcie Meddows, Maria Callinan and Laurie Morris 184 poems by ten Australian authors
175 performance poems Lots of FUN poems as well as thought-provoking lyrics. These poems will encourage children to read. They will grasp the concepts immediately and relate to them. |
